Yury Alekseevich Kryukov, Igor Valentinovich Enyutin, Oleg Olegovich Tsyganov, Smart Relay Protection of Electric Networks: Response Speed, Sensitivity and Selectivity Test with Use of a Physical Network Model, Journal of Engineering and Applied Sciences, Volume 11,Issue 6, 2016, Pages 1146-1150, ISSN 1816-949x, jeasci.2016.1146.1150, (https://makhillpublications.co/view-article.php?doi=jeasci.2016.1146.1150) Abstract: This study presents issues on experimental testing os response speed, sensitivity and selectivity with use of the breadboard for smart relay protection of electrical networks that was developed in the University "Dubna". Testing was performed using a physical model of an electrical network comprising transmission lines, power transformers, electric motors, generalized load and substation buses. Method of emergencies simulation in the model, key points of the investigation tests to determine response speed, sensitivity and selectivity are described. Specific examples of determining these parameters for the electrical network model are shown.
